Kerala Forests Nab Ashwin-Led Tiger Trafficking Gang

Seven Arrested, Tiger Skin & Parts Seized in Kannur

Kannur, Kerala: Forest officials in Kerala have arrested seven individuals involved in wildlife trafficking after seizing tiger skin, claws, and teeth in a major crackdown. The operation, conducted in Kannur district, followed confidential intelligence about an attempted sale of these animal parts.

Acting on a tip-off late Friday night, officials launched a coordinated operation in Kathiroor, Thalassery taluk. The first arrests included Ashwin from Eruvatti, along with Sandheesh and Balan from Cheruvanchery, who were caught trying to sell the tiger products.

Subsequent inquiries led to the detention of four more suspects: Sharath KK of Kallikandy, Rajeesh of Mangad, Vithul from Cheruvanchery, and Rakhil from Malal. Authorities also confiscated an Innova car, allegedly used to transport tiger parts, and a scooter involved in the operation.

Veterinary specialists confirmed that the seized items belonged to a tiger, and the components have been sent for DNA testing to support the ongoing investigation.

The operation was led by Forest Range Officer Nithinraj of Kottiyoor, along with the Kannur Forest Vigilance Unit, involving multiple forest personnel to tackle wildlife crime collaboratively.

The seven suspects were presented before the Thalassery Judicial First Class Magistrate Court on Saturday and remanded to judicial custody. Forest officials plan to seek custody for further interrogation.

Preliminary investigations suggest that the gang may have connections with poachers in Karnataka, though it remains unclear if they directly sourced the tiger skin. Authorities continue to gather evidence on the trafficking network to prevent further illegal wildlife trade.
